Phil Knell Career Innings Pitched Overview
During Phil Knell's 6-year Major League Baseball career, he had a lifetime total of
1452.33 innings pitched, an average of 242.06 innings pitched per season. 1891 was his best season
with 462 innings pitched and his worst season was 1888 when he had
26.3333 innings pitched. Phil Knell is middlin' tier compared to similar player cohorts career totals, not clearly beating or

Innings pitched is a calculated value of the number of inning a pitcher has pitched. Innings pitched is calcuated by taking innings pitched outs over a giving time period and divding by 3, this means that pitcher can pitch one third (.33), two thirds (.66), or full innings (1.0). Generally, for Innings Pitched, higher is better. (Source)
